企业级可观测性如何支持跨平台监控?
在当今数字化时代,企业级可观测性已成为企业稳定运行、提升服务质量和优化用户体验的关键因素。随着企业业务日益复杂,跨平台监控成为企业级可观测性的重要组成部分。本文将深入探讨企业级可观测性如何支持跨平台监控,并分析其带来的优势。
一、企业级可观测性的内涵
企业级可观测性是指通过收集、分析和可视化企业内部系统的运行数据,实现对系统性能、资源利用、业务流程等方面的全面监控。它包括以下几个核心要素:
- 数据采集:通过日志、指标、事件等多种方式,全面收集系统运行数据。
- 数据处理:对采集到的数据进行清洗、转换、聚合等处理,为后续分析提供高质量的数据基础。
- 数据分析:运用统计学、机器学习等方法,对处理后的数据进行深入分析,挖掘潜在问题和优化空间。
- 可视化:将分析结果以图表、报表等形式直观展示,便于用户快速了解系统状态。
二、跨平台监控的挑战
随着企业业务的发展,跨平台监控成为企业级可观测性的重要组成部分。然而,跨平台监控面临着以下挑战:
- 平台差异性:不同平台具有不同的架构、技术栈和监控工具,导致监控指标、数据格式等方面存在差异。
- 数据孤岛:由于平台之间的数据隔离,难以实现跨平台的数据整合和分析。
- 性能瓶颈:跨平台监控需要处理大量数据,对系统性能提出较高要求。
三、企业级可观测性如何支持跨平台监控
为了解决跨平台监控的挑战,企业级可观测性可以从以下几个方面提供支持:
- 统一监控框架:构建统一的监控框架,支持不同平台的数据采集、处理和分析,实现跨平台监控的统一管理。
- 标准化数据格式:制定统一的数据格式标准,确保不同平台的数据可以无缝对接,消除数据孤岛。
- 性能优化:通过分布式架构、缓存技术等手段,提高跨平台监控的性能,确保系统稳定运行。
四、案例分析
以下是一些企业级可观测性支持跨平台监控的案例分析:
- 阿里巴巴:阿里巴巴通过自主研发的Apsara平台,实现了跨平台、跨地域的监控。Apsara平台采用统一的数据格式和监控框架,为阿里巴巴的电商、金融等业务提供了强大的监控能力。
- 腾讯:腾讯的监控体系基于开源的Prometheus和Grafana等工具,实现了跨平台、跨地域的监控。通过自定义监控指标和可视化报表,腾讯可以实时了解业务运行状态,及时发现和解决问题。
五、总结
企业级可观测性在支持跨平台监控方面发挥着重要作用。通过构建统一的监控框架、标准化数据格式和优化性能,企业可以实现对不同平台、不同地域的全面监控,从而提升系统稳定性、优化用户体验。随着技术的不断发展,企业级可观测性将在跨平台监控领域发挥更大的作用。
猜你喜欢:全景性能监控